1. Background of Gypsy Rose Blanchard

Gypsy Rose Blanchard was born on July 27, 1991, in Baton Rouge, Louisiana. Her early life was marked by severe medical abuse by her mother, Dee Dee Blanchard, who claimed that Gypsy suffered from numerous ailments, including leukemia, muscular dystrophy, and various other health issues. This led to Gypsy being subjected to unnecessary medical treatments, including surgeries and medications, all while being confined to a wheelchair despite her ability to walk.

Gypsy's childhood was characterized by a lack of freedom and control over her own life. Dee Dee's manipulation of her daughter's health created a traumatic environment, leaving Gypsy emotionally and psychologically scarred. Despite the abuse, Gypsy maintained a facade of compliance, as she was conditioned to believe that she was sick and that her mother was her only protector.

Their life together was further complicated by the arrival of online interactions, where Gypsy sought connections with others outside her suffocating home environment. This desire for freedom and normalcy would ultimately lead to the tragic events that unfolded in June 2015.

2. The Crime: What Happened?

The turning point in the Gypsy Rose case occurred on June 14, 2015, when Dee Dee Blanchard was found dead in their home in Springfield, Missouri. Gypsy was discovered missing, prompting a nationwide search. It was soon revealed that Gypsy had conspired with her then-boyfriend, Nicholas Godejohn, to murder her mother. The plan was born out of desperation for freedom from the control and abuse Gypsy had endured for years.

On the night of the murder, Gypsy and Nicholas committed the act that would change their lives forever. Following the murder, Gypsy and Nicholas fled to his home in Wisconsin, where they were apprehended shortly after. This shocking turn of events not only stunned the public but also raised questions about the dynamics of their relationship and the severe impact of abuse.

Following their arrest, Gypsy Rose and Nicholas Godejohn faced legal proceedings that captured the attention of the nation. Gypsy was charged with second-degree murder, while Nicholas was charged with first-degree murder. The court proceedings revealed the complexities of Gypsy's situation, as her defense argued that she was a victim of abuse and manipulation.

In 2016, Gypsy accepted a plea deal, receiving a sentence of 10 years in prison, which many viewed as a form of justice for the years of abuse she endured. Nicholas Godejohn, on the other hand, was found guilty and received a life sentence without the possibility of parole. The contrasting sentences sparked discussions about the legal system's treatment of victims of abuse and the nuances of self-defense in cases of domestic violence.

5. Impact on Society and Mental Health Awareness

The Gypsy Rose case has had a profound impact on society, particularly in raising awareness about Munchausen syndrome by proxy and the signs of child abuse. It has prompted discussions about the responsibilities of medical professionals, educators, and the community in identifying and intervening in cases of abuse.

Furthermore, the case has shed light on the importance of mental health support for victims of abuse. Gypsy's story serves as a reminder of the long-term effects of trauma and the need for comprehensive mental health services for survivors. As society continues to grapple with these issues, the Gypsy Rose case remains a pivotal example of the complexities involved in understanding and addressing abuse.
